Understanding the Role of Futures Trading Brokers

Futures trading brokers play a vital role in facilitating transactions for individuals and institutions in the futures market. As intermediaries, they connect buyers and sellers, enabling traders to enter into futures contracts on various underlying assets such as commodities, currencies, and stock market indices.

Key Point: Futures trading brokers act as a bridge between traders and the futures exchanges, executing orders on behalf of their clients and providing access to the necessary trading infrastructure.

These brokers offer online trading platforms and tools that allow traders to monitor market conditions, analyze price movements, and execute trades. Additionally, they provide valuable research and analysis, educational resources, and customer support to help traders make informed decisions.

Regulations and Licensing

Regulations play a crucial role in ensuring the integrity and transparency of the futures market. In the USA, futures trading brokers are subject to oversight by regulatory bodies such as the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) and the National Futures Association (NFA).

Key Point: It is important to choose a futures trading broker that is regulated by these authorities to ensure they adhere to industry standards and comply with legal requirements.

Firms operating as futures brokers must obtain appropriate licensing to offer brokerage services. The licensing process involves meeting certain financial and operational requirements, as well as demonstrating the necessary expertise and experience in the field.

Understanding Different Types of Fees and Commissions

Before diving into the process of comparing fees and commissions, it’s essential to have a clear understanding of the different types of charges you may encounter when trading futures. These charges can vary from broker to broker but generally fall into the following categories:

  • Commission per trade: This is a fee that the broker charges for executing each trade on your behalf. It can be a fixed dollar amount or a percentage of the trade’s value.
  • Exchange fees: These fees are charged by the futures exchange for each contract traded and are usually passed on to the trader by the broker.
  • Clearing fees: Clearing fees are charged by the clearinghouse, which acts as an intermediary between the buyer and seller of a futures contract. These fees cover the cost of clearing and settling the trade.
  • Market data fees: If you require real-time market data for your trading strategy, you may need to pay additional fees to access this information.

Understanding these different types of fees and commissions will help you evaluate the overall cost of trading with different brokers.

Comparing Inclusive vs. À la Carte Fee Structures

Brokers may offer two types of fee structures – inclusive and à la carte. Inclusive fee structures typically bundle all the fees mentioned earlier into a single commission per trade. This can simplify the cost calculation process as you only need to consider one fee. On the other hand, à la carte fee structures break down the fees separately, allowing you to see exactly how much you are being charged for each component. This level of transparency can be beneficial if you want more control over the fees you pay. Consider your trading style and preferences to determine which fee structure works best for you.

Exploring Brokers for Scalping and High-Frequency Trading

Scalping and high-frequency trading are trading styles that require brokers with advanced technology and low-latency execution. To engage in these fast-paced trading strategies, it is crucial to choose a futures trading broker that offers direct market access with minimal order execution delays. Look for brokers that have a reliable and stable trading infrastructure with high-speed connections to the futures exchanges. Additionally, consider brokers that offer co-location services, which allow you to place your trading servers in close proximity to the exchange servers, minimizing any latency issues.
